Girls wrestling competes at Monrovia Invitational

By Jason Perry | Dec 7, 2025 3:57 PM

IMG_5260.png

December 7, 2025 - Zahlynn Williams earned fourth place in her weight class, including three victories by fall, helping the Bull Dogs to a 15th place finish at the 28-team Monrovia Invitational. Nitya Hurli lost both matches, while Alona Call and Fatima Aguilar each finished with a win and two losses for the tournament. The Dogs got sixth-place finishes from Paris Lopez, Leslie Bridges, Aubreigh Campbell, and Morgan Clark. Head Coach Lindsey Prozanski saw lots of growth in the Dogs’ matches and is excited to get back to practice as they prepare for a home match against Madison on Tuesday, December 9. The meet is scheduled to get started at 6:00 pm.
